The episode begins with Helck's return from the Demon Lord's castle, where he encounters Azudra, one of the four elite lords of the empire. Azudra explains that the demonkin are not responsible for the monster attacks on the human kingdom. The fortress Helck visited was meant to prevent the monsters from spawning, and the recent siege disrupted this function. Azudra also reveals that the demonkin once lived in harmony with humans and wish to restore this friendship.

Helck returns to the royal capital, where he finds his mercenary friends Alicia and Edil in a tense situation. During a monster attack, the nobles closed the gates and forced the mercenaries into a battle they could no longer retreat from. Helck learns that many soldiers and mercenaries have died as a result of this decision.

The kingdom captures some surviving demons from the battle against the Demon Lord and treats them cruelly. Helck intervenes and urges the crowd to stop the abuse. This turns the crowd against him, branding him a heretic. One of the captive demons warns Helck about the "power of the New World" lurking among humans.

Lord Raphaed, a mysterious figure, appears and manipulates the situation to make the demons appear evil. He transforms the captive demons into monsters, reinforcing the belief in the demonkin's malevolence. Despite this, Helck remains skeptical about the true nature of the demonkin.

The kingdom announces the development of a technique called "Awakening," which can artificially enhance human abilities. This reduces the number of casualties from monster attacks and improves the kingdom's situation. However, Helck is still doubtful about the demonkin and decides to confide in his friends.

The episode ends with Helck inviting Alicia to a restaurant to talk about his concerns.
